The transistor output with base access gives the designer flexibility to tailor the switching threshold or add base-emitter capacitance for noise filtering. ## CTR spread and switching-speed trade-offs Current transfer ratio (CTR) is specified at 19% min to 50% max at a forward current of 16 mA. That 2.6:1 spread means the output pull-up resistor and the LED drive current must be chosen so the circuit works at the low end without saturating the output transistor at the high end — a common design-in discipline for this family. Typical turn-on time is 450 ns and turn-off is 300 ns, which supports data rates up to roughly 1 MHz. For PWM or serial isolation below that frequency, the propagation delay is well within the timing budget of most PLC input modules or gate-drive feedback paths.
